What Is a Prop Firm?
A proprietary trading firm, commonly known as a prop firm, is a capital provider that allows traders to trade with company-funded accounts instead of risking their own money.
In return, the trader shares a percentage of the profits with the firm.
The standard process at most prop firms is as follows:
- You purchase a trading challenge.
- You trade while following predefined risk-management rules, such as daily loss limits, maximum drawdown, and profit targets.
- If you reach the profit target without violating the rules, you receive a funded account.
- You then trade using the firm’s capital and typically receive between 80% and 90% of the profits.
The key point is simple:
In the prop trading model, the capital at risk belongs to the firm. The trader’s maximum financial exposure is generally limited to the challenge fee—not the entire $50,000 or $100,000 account balance.

Step 1: Evaluate Yourself Before Purchasing a Challenge
Before purchasing any prop challenge, answer several questions honestly:
- On which timeframes and trading instruments does your strategy perform best?
- What is your average drawdown?
- What is your typical risk-to-reward ratio?
- Have you demonstrated consistent results on a demo or test account for at least several months?
- Can you follow predefined risk rules under pressure?
To support traders during this stage, MyProp may provide a free or low-cost test account that allows them to evaluate their strategy in a simulated environment.
The MyProp blog also includes articles such as “How to Pass a Prop Firm Challenge,” which address the preparation required before purchasing an account.
If you conclude that your strategy is not yet sufficiently tested, the most rational decision is to delay the purchase.
Instead:
- Continue learning and practicing.
- Record your trades in a trading journal.
- Test your rules under different market conditions.
- Use MyProp’s free challenges and educational resources to build a more stable system.
